I had a lot of trouble getting the duct to work without running the downlight, but I think I've finally got it right. This version is perfect if you don't want to install a downlight. I had some problems with the front of the duct catching on prints earlier, but this new design fixes that issue completely. I made some changes recently to make the profile more streamlined. The big cutout in the middle is there to support the downlighting. A 60mm 12V halo light fits perfectly around the heater block and is supported by the fan duct. Print this part before you install your volcano setup, I used ABS and supports are essential. This simple part fan works wonderfully for running a volcano on my MK2 printer. The duct is doing its job now and the heater block isn't getting clogged with air anymore. You may need to tweak it to fit your specific setup, but I'm really happy with how it turned out.
